Why Chimney Inspection in St. Louis, MO Is So Important
St. Louis experiences wide temperature swings throughout the year. Therefore, masonry expands and contracts during freeze-thaw cycles. Over time, this movement creates cracks, gaps, and airflow issues.
In neighborhoods like Soulard, Tower Grove, and South City, many homes feature aging chimney structures. As a result, routine chimney inspection in St. Louis becomes essential for identifying early-stage damage.
Moreover, inspections help ensure safe fireplace use. When airflow works correctly, smoke and gases exit the home as intended.

Frequently Asked Questions
How often should a chimney inspection be scheduled?
Most homeowners benefit from an annual inspection, especially before regular winter fireplace use.
What problems can an inspection uncover?
Inspections often reveal cracks, moisture damage, airflow issues, and blockages that are not visible from inside the home.
